CNC Machine From Digital Design to High Accuracy Industrial Parts
Discover how CNC machines transform digital designs into high-precision industrial components with incredible accuracy and efficiency. In this video, we take you through the complete CNC machining process — from CAD design to final production.
CNC (Computer Numerical Control) technology uses computer-programmed instructions to control cutting tools and machinery, enabling the production of complex parts with consistent quality and tight tolerances.

From metal and plastic to wood and composites, CNC machining is widely used in industries like automotive, aerospace, and manufacturing due to its precision, repeatability, and speed.
